How much do temporary inspector j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 22, 2026, the average yearly pay for temporary inspector in Austin, TX is $54,456.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$38,200.00 and $62,900.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ges faced by Temporary Inspectors, and how can they be addressed?

Temporary Inspectors often face the challenge of quickly adapting to new environments and workflows, as assignments may vary by location or project. They must rapidly familiarize themselves with specific regulations, procedures, and reporting requirements unique to each assignment. Building rapport with permanent staff and effectively communicating findings can also be challenging when working on a temporary basis. To address these challenges, it's helpful to be proactive in seeking out relevant documentation, asking clarifying questions early on, and demonstrating flexibility and professionalism in all interactions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Temporary Inspector,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Temporary Inspector, you require a solid understanding of inspection procedures, attention to detail, and relevant industry knowledge, often supported by a high school diploma or specialized training. Familiarity with inspection tools, reporting software, and regulatory standards is typically necessary. Strong observational skills, integrity, and effective communication help inspectors accurately document findings and interact with various stakeholders. These abilities ensure that inspections are thorough, compliant, and contribute to maintaining safety and quality standards.

What is a Temporary Inspector?

A Temporary Inspector is a professional hired for a short-term period to examine and evaluate materials, processes, or completed work to ensure they meet specific standards and regulations. These inspectors may work in various industries, such as construction, manufacturing, or public safety, and are typically brought in to address increased workloads or to fill in for permanent staff. Their duties often include conducting site visits, preparing reports, and identifying any issues that require attention. The role requires attention to detail, knowledge of relevant codes or guidelines, and strong communication skills.

What You’ll Do:

As a Quality Inspector, you will:

  • Inspect & Approve Materials: Perform visual and dimensional inspections to verify incoming materials and production outputs meet specifications.
  • Use Precision Tools: Work with calipers, micrometers, CMMs, and other equipment to ensure exact measurements and tolerances.
  • Conduct First Article Inspections (FAI): Validate new or updated parts and processes before full-scale production.
  • Identify & Manage Non-Conformances: Segregate, document, and support disposition of defective materials to prevent production issues.
  • Drive Quality Improvements: Participate in root cause analysis and corrective actions to continuously improve processes and product reliability.
  • Maintain Accurate Documentation: Record inspection results, calibration data, and quality metrics clearly and thoroughly.
  • Collaborate Cross-Functionally: Work closely with production, engineering, and quality teams to resolve issues and maintain standards.
  • Support Equipment & Calibration: Ensure inspection tools remain accurate and compliant with calibration requirements.

What You Bring:Core Qualifications
  • Experience in quality inspection or quality control within a manufacturing environment
  • Proficiency with precision measurement tools (calipers, micrometers, etc.)
  • Strong ability to read and interpret engineering drawings, BOMs, and 2D/3D models
  • Hands-on experience with First Article Inspections (FAI)
  • Familiarity with CMM equipment or similar technologies
  • Solid math and measurement skills (tolerances, counts, dimensions)
  • Excellent attention to detail and accuracy
